Welsh pupils show off Winter Olympics skills
The next generation of winter sports stars from Wales have been showing off their skills in front of recent Olympic heroes. Isaac Taylor, Charlotte Mayne, Neil Lane and Jake Williams, all 7 years old and from Llandaff Cathedral School in Cardiff, competed at the first SNO!ympics in Milton Keynes.
They were watched by Amy Williams, who won gold in the skeleton bobsleigh at the Winter Olympics in Vancouver in 2010, becoming Britain's first solo champion for 30 years.
In this competition, run by Ice Age, a school England beat those from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land to triumph.
